About the role
- This role will serve as a key technical liaison for vendor collaboration and test and evaluation activities.
- This position will also serve as the on-site technical interface for test and evaluation activities associated with DARPA's Quantum Benchmarking Initiative (QBI) and related programs.
- The role involves coordinating subsystem evaluation, test protocols, and milestone documentation.
Responsibilities
- Evaluate potential architectures, technologies, and vendor solutions that support higher-power and more scalable laser subsystems.
- Serve as the technical point of contact for vendors developing laser and optical subsystems.
- Coordinate subsystem testing, qualification, and integration activities with external partners.
- Support vendor evaluation, component qualification, and performance verification for critical optical hardware.
- Support milestone documentation, technical reporting, and data collection for federal research programs.
- Collaborate with photonics, optics, and quantum systems teams to define subsystem interface requirements and integration workflows.
- Support procurement, documentation, and lifecycle management of laser and optical components.
- Participate in cross-site coordination with QuEra engineering teams and external research partners.
Requirements
- 5+ years of hands-on experience operating or maintaining advanced laser systems.
- Experience working with free-space optics, fiber optics, and optomechanical assemblies.
- Familiarity with laser control electronics, feedback systems, or instrumentation used in optical experiments.
- Experience working in laboratory or prototype environments with uptime or experimental reliability requirements.
- ~20% travel to partner facilities and vendor sites is required.
- Strong skills in optical alignment, beam diagnostics, and troubleshooting complex optical systems.
- Solid understanding of laser safety practices for high-power optical systems.
Nice to have
- Master's or Ph.D. in Optics, Physics, Electrical Engineering, Photonics, or a related field.
- Experience with AMO systems, cold-atom experiments, or photonics platforms for quantum technologies.
- Familiarity with laser stabilization techniques (familiarity with laser characterization and performance verification techniques).
- Prior experience working on DARPA, DOE, or other federally funded R&D programs and preparing milestone documentation.
- Strong technical communication and documentation skills.
